Kansas City Chiefs found their replacement for Mike Devito in Kyle Love.
Kyle Love was a very good football player for the New England Patriots before being released due to having diabetes. Love was signed by the Jaguars and released a few weeks later. He has not been on a roster in quite some time, but he will be ready to go this week.
The Chiefs cut Anthony Toribio in a corresponding roster move. He’ll be making his 2013 debut if he’s active for Sunday’s game against the Chargers. Love has 25 games of starting experience, and provides insurance for a defensive line that could be missing RE Mike DeVito in Week 12.
